What types of care does Buffalo Prairie Center for Rehab and Healthcare provide? + −
Buffalo Prairie Center specializes in skilled nursing care, including short-term post-acute rehabilitation and long-term nursing care. Therapy services — physical, occupational, and speech — are available to help residents recover from surgeries, strokes, falls, and other medical events, with 24-hour licensed nursing on-site.
What hospitals are near Buffalo Prairie Center? + −
Citizens Memorial Hospital in Bolivar, Missouri is the closest full-service hospital, approximately 25 miles north of Buffalo. For advanced specialty care, Cox Health and Mercy Hospital Springfield are both located in Springfield, roughly 45–50 miles away, and can be coordinated with the facility's care team when needed.

What is Buffalo, Missouri like for seniors and visiting families? + −
Buffalo is a small, close-knit community in the Missouri Ozarks serving as the Dallas County seat. It offers a quiet, rural atmosphere with the charm of a historic downtown centered on the Dallas County Courthouse. The pace of life is unhurried, outdoor scenery is beautiful year-round, and families visiting from across the region will find the town easy to navigate with local dining and shopping along Main Street.
